Samsung beefs up its printer portfolio

By Damian Koh

Samsung today reinforced its resolution to become a major IT player in the region by showcasing the company's latest products, among them a whole range of printers.

A total of 11 laser, multifunction and compact photo printers were showcased at this afternoon's IT Roadshow. The spotlight was clearly on the CLP-300 and the CLX-3160FN, which Samsung touted as the world's smallest and lightest color laser and multifunctional printers, respectively.

The company is targeting to grow its IT business by at least 35 percent in Southeast Asia this year. More specifically, it wishes to expand its printer business in the B2B market where it currently holds the title of world's second-largest monochrome laser printer manufacturer, with HP leading the category.

The CLP-300, which was first unveiled at CES 2006 in Las Vegas, is slated for launch in October this year. According to Samsung, the CLP-300 has the smallest footprint in the color laser printer category and features the company's patented NO-NOIS technology which, as its name suggests, would suit quiet working environments.

 Did you know?
NO-NOIS stands for Non-orbiting Noiseless Optic Imaging System.

Besides the new hardware, Samsung also introduced several office management solutions aimed at helping its users work more effectively and efficiently. These initiatives include the Confidential Print which requires the consumer to key in a PIN (Personal Identification Number) before the print job will be released; SecuPrint which allows an administrator to track and control the printing activity of any document; and Print Audit which monitors the usage of printers in order for companies to manage their costs more effectively.
